## Deployment

The user module now runs as its own service, Splitwick-Users, carved out of the Hollowbarn monolith. Deploy it before the monolith; the monolith falls back to its embedded module if the service is unreachable. Sessions are shared via the token bridge. Scale to at least two replicas. The service boots from the config block that follows.

deployment values, faduf-tawep:
SORDOR_LOG_LEVEL=error
SORDOR_METRICS_HOST=metrics.sordor.nelvrolabs.internal
SORDOR_POOL_SIZE=4

# Charsleuth encoding-detection service — environment file
# Support team: this file controls how uploaded text files are sniffed
# before conversion to UTF-8. Do not change DETECT_SAMPLE_BYTES without
# checking with the ingest crew, as it affects accuracy on short files.
# Fallback behavior and confidence thresholds are documented on the wiki.
# The detector also needs a credential to report results upstream,
# and that credential is set on the very next line.

secret setting of yagef-baweg: RELAY_SECRET29=cb53deb59a49ed54d9f43599b54ca

All — confirming we are proceeding with the Veylant expansion. Timeline: sales office in Carstow by Q2, distribution hub by Q4. Marlo Detrick will lead regional operations. Budget approved at last week's steering session; department allocations follow by Friday. Expect hiring requests for logistics, sales, and support roles. Hold external announcements until legal clears the entity registration. Questions to the expansion working group, not reply-all. There is one point I need to flag separately below.

confidential, kagep-kahof: Druokax Systems plans to lower the Ulaath list price by 53 percent in March.

**Ticket: BounceBox config drift on worker-2**

New folks: worker-2's bounce processor drifted from the repo config again. Retry limits and the suppression-list TTL were changed by hand, so hard bounces are being retried when they shouldn't be. Fix is to redeploy from source. For reference, here's what worker-2 is currently running.

service settings:
[casax]
port = 6379
team = rusir
host = casax.zemvarhq.corp
region = outer-4
access_code = ac_9808ce
timeout_ms = 1500